Description: MovieMator is an easy-to-use video editing software for beginners. It provides basic video editing features like trimming, splitting, adding transitions, titles, effects, and background music. The interface is intuitive with various themes and templates.

Description: BlazeVideo SmartShow is a video editing software that allows users to easily create professional-looking videos. It has a user-friendly interface and powerful features like timeline editing, effects, transitions, text overlays, and more.
